Sebastian Vettel gains no sympathy from the McLaren F1 Boss, Andreas Seidl

2021 is shaping up to be an important season for ex Ferrari Driver, Sebastian Vettel. He’ll want to avenge his results from last year, and answer his critics. But with a few obstacles in testing and a super-competitive mid-field during the races, it’ll be quite challenging for Vettel to come out as the best of the rest. He’ll need to start strong, or else the season could unravel pretty quickly. 

However, the McLaren team principal reckons Vettel will come out firing on all cylinders right from the opening round on March 28. Andreas Seidl believes Vettel’s experience holds him in good stead and backs him to turn things around this year. 

Andreas Seidl on Sebastian Vettel

He said (translated via Google), “You don’t have to feel sorry for Sebastian. He’s a four-time world champion and very experienced. I think he can put up with the bad luck he probably had because of his experience.” 

Seidl expects the British outfit and Vettel to cause his team some headaches. He said, “I assume that Aston Martin will be very competitive with Sebastian from the first race and will be a tough opponent for us.” 

Nevertheless, Andreas hopes his team can stay in the reckoning for the third-place battle. Although he acknowledges that behind Mercedes and Red Bull, the order of the chasing pack is hard to decipher.
